#!/usr/bin/perl -w
# Some basic GraphML tests with the format=yED
use Test::More;
use strict;
use utf8;
BEGIN
{
plan tests => 14;
chdir 't' if -d 't';
use lib '../lib';
use_ok ("Graph::Easy") or die($@);
use_ok ("Graph::Easy::Parser") or die($@);
};
can_ok ('Graph::Easy', qw/
as_graphml
as_graphml_file
/);
#############################################################################
my $graph = Graph::Easy->new();
my $graphml_file = $graph->as_graphml_file( format => 'yED' );
$graphml_file =~ s/\n.*<!--.*-->\n//;
_compare ($graph, $graphml_file, 'as_graphml and as_graphml_file are equal');
my $graphml = $graph->as_graphml( format => 'yED' );
like ($graphml, qr/<\?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"\?>/, 'as_graphml looks like xml');
#############################################################################
# some nodes and edges
$graph->add_edge('Ursel','Viersen');
$graphml = $graph->as_graphml();
like ($graphml, qr/<node.*id="Ursel"/, 'as_graphml contains nodes');
like ($graphml, qr/<node.*id="Viersen"/, 'as_graphml contains nodes');
like ($graphml, qr/<edge.*source="Ursel"/, 'as_graphml contains edge');
like ($graphml, qr/<edge.*target="Viersen"/, 'as_graphml contains edge');
#############################################################################
# some attributes:
# node.foo { color: red; } [A] {class:foo;}-> { color: blue; } [B]
$graph = Graph::Easy->new();
my ($A,$B,$edge) = $graph->add_edge('A','B');
$graph->set_attribute('node.foo','color','red');
$edge->set_attribute('color','blue');
$A->set_attribute('class','foo');
my $result = <<EOT
<key id="d0" for="node" attr.name="color" attr.type="string">
<default>black</default>
</key>
<key id="d1" for="edge" attr.name="color" attr.type="string">
<default>black</default>
</key>
<graph id="G" edgedefault="directed">
<node id="A">
<data key="d0">red</data>
</node>
<node id="B">
</node>
<edge source="A" target="B">
<data key="d1">blue</data>
</edge>
</graph>
</graphml>
EOT
;
_compare($graph, $result, 'GraphML with attributes');
#############################################################################
# some attributes with no default valu with no default value:
# Also test escaping for valid XML:
$edge->set_attribute('label', 'train-station & <Überlingen "Süd">');
$result = <<EOT2
<key id="d0" for="node" attr.name="color" attr.type="string">
<default>black</default>
</key>
<key id="d1" for="edge" attr.name="color" attr.type="string">
<default>black</default>
</key>
<key id="d2" for="edge" attr.name="label" attr.type="string"/>
<graph id="G" edgedefault="directed">
<node id="A">
<data key="d0">red</data>
</node>
<node id="B">
</node>
<edge source="A" target="B">
<data key="d1">blue</data>
<data key="d2">train-station & <Überlingen "Süd"></data>
</edge>
</graph>
</graphml>
EOT2
;
_compare($graph, $result, 'GraphML with attributes');
#############################################################################
# node names with things that need escaping:
$graph->rename_node('A', '<&\'">');
$result = <<EOT3
<key id="d0" for="node" attr.name="color" attr.type="string">
<default>black</default>
</key>
<key id="d1" for="edge" attr.name="color" attr.type="string">
<default>black</default>
</key>
<key id="d2" for="edge" attr.name="label" attr.type="string"/>
<graph id="G" edgedefault="directed">
<node id="<&'">">
<data key="d0">red</data>
</node>
<node id="B">
</node>
<edge source="<&'">" target="B">
<data key="d1">blue</data>
<data key="d2">train-station & <Überlingen "Süd"></data>
</edge>
</graph>
</graphml>
EOT3
;
_compare($graph, $result, 'GraphML with attributes');
#############################################################################
# double attributes
$graph = Graph::Easy->new();
($A,$B,$edge) = $graph->add_edge('A','B');
my ($C,$D,$edge2) = $graph->add_edge('A','C');
$edge->set_attribute('label','car');
$edge2->set_attribute('label','train');
$result = <<EOT4
<key id="d0" for="edge" attr.name="label" attr.type="string"/>
<graph id="G" edgedefault="directed">
<node id="A">
</node>
<node id="B">
</node>
<node id="C">
</node>
<edge source="A" target="B">
<data key="d0">car</data>
</edge>
<edge source="A" target="C">
<data key="d0">train</data>
</edge>
</graph>
</graphml>
EOT4
;
_compare($graph, $result, 'GraphML with attributes');
#############################################################################
# as_graphml() with groups (bug until v0.63):
$graph = Graph::Easy->new();
my $bonn = Graph::Easy::Node->new('Bonn');
my $cities = $graph->add_group('Cities"');
$cities->add_nodes($bonn);
$result = <<EOT5
<graph id="G" edgedefault="directed">
<graph id="Cities"" edgedefault="directed">
<node id="Bonn">
</node>
</graph>
</graph>
</graphml>
EOT5
;
_compare($graph, $result, 'GraphML with group');
# all tests done
#############################################################################
#############################################################################
sub _compare
{
my ($graph, $result, $name) = @_;
my $graphml = $graph->as_graphml( { format => 'yED' } );
$graphml =~ s/\n.*<!--.*-->\n//;
$result = <<EOR
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<graphml xmlns="http://graphml.graphdrawing.org/xmlns"
x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ance"
xmlns:y="http://www.yworks.com/xml/graphml"
xsi:schemaLocation="http://graphml.graphdrawing.org/xmlns
http://www.yworks.com/xml/schema/graphml/1.0/ygraphml.xsd">
EOR
. $result unless $result =~ /<\?xml/;
if (!is ($result, $graphml, $name))
{
eval { require Test::Differences; };
if (defined $Test::Differences::VERSION)
{
Test::Differences::eq_or_diff ($result, $graphml);
}
}
}
